CEES celebrates James Retallack's appointment to the Order of Canada
The Centre for European and Eurasian Studies (CEES) is thrilled to congratulate Professor Emeritus James Retallack on his recent appointment to the Order of Canada - one of the highest civilian honours in our country. Professor Retallack was among 80 individuals, including several other University of Toronto faculty, to be recognized by the Governor General for "outstanding achievement, dedication to the community, and service to the nation."
In the Order of Canada citation, Professor Retallack is described as "Canada’s leading scholar of modern German history. Recognized as an international authority in the field, he has advanced public debate about democracy. As one of the first Anglo-American academics to conduct research in the former East Germany, he has uncovered new sources and writes innovatively about political history."
Governor General Mary Simon released a statement, along with the announcement of this latest round of appointees, on December 31, 2025. "The Order of Canada fosters a sense of pride and cohesion in our country," she said. "Every appointment celebrates not only the talent, expertise, and dedication of individuals, but also the countless lives they have touched through their work, vision, and contributions. Their commitment extends beyond borders, inspiring progress in our communities, our country, and around the world."
